Chlorine in PDB 5ag4: Crystal Structure of Leishmania Major N- Myristoyltransferase (Nmt) with Bound Myristoyl-Coa and A Thiazolidinone Ligand

Enzymatic activity of Crystal Structure of Leishmania Major N- Myristoyltransferase (Nmt) with Bound Myristoyl-Coa and A Thiazolidinone Ligand

All present enzymatic activity of Crystal Structure of Leishmania Major N- Myristoyltransferase (Nmt) with Bound Myristoyl-Coa and A Thiazolidinone Ligand:
2.3.1.97;

Protein crystallography data

The structure of Crystal Structure of Leishmania Major N- Myristoyltransferase (Nmt) with Bound Myristoyl-Coa and A Thiazolidinone Ligand, PDB code: 5ag4 was solved by D.A.Robinson, D.Spinks, V.C.Smith, S.Thompson, A.Smith, L.S.Torrie, S.P.Mcelroy, S.Brand, R.Brenk, J.A.Frearson, K.D.Read, P.G.Wyatt, I.H.Gilbert,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 19.97 / 1.99
Space group P 1 21 1
Cell size a, b, c (Å), α, β, γ (°) 48.710, 90.884, 53.867, 90.00, 113.48, 90.00
R / Rfree (%) 18.236 / 24.674
